During a free fall Swati was accelerating at -9.8m/s2. After 120 seconds how far did she travel? Use the formula =1/2 * t^2 to solve your answer. (Do not forget to keep units in your answer.)

Answer:

70560 m

Step-by-step explanation:

The formula to calculate the distance travelled during a free fall motion is


d=-(1)/(2)gt^2

where

d is the distance travelled

g = -9.8 m/s^2 is the acceleration due to gravity

t is the time

In this situation,

t = 120 s

Therefore the distance travelled after 120 s is


d=-(1)/(2)(-9.8)(120)^2=70560 m
